## Tuning

The Hawthornden catalogue importer for the Brindlemere Library Network is sensitive to batch size and retry spacing. If overnight MARC imports stall, check worker saturation before touching concurrency — oversized batches cause lock contention on the holdings table. Adjust conservatively and one constant at a time. The defaults we recommend are listed here.

tuning table, yajog-yahof:
BUDGETS = {
    "lamvan": 303,
    "wenox": 460,
    "fenvan": 525,
}

Adds bulk edit to the Ledgerpane admin table. All mutations go through the existing permission check per row; no batch bypass. CSRF token required, audit log entry per changed field. Rate limiting prevents mass-update abuse from a compromised session. Limits on batch size and throttling are set by these constants.

tuning constants:
RATE_LIMITS = {
    "wenwyn": 1,
    "zorix": 10,
    "oliix": 2,
    "holael": 10,
}

Internal Memo — Pricing Adjustment, Helvane Product Line

Branch managers: effective the first of next quarter, list prices across the Helvane line will rise by 6%, with the entry-tier Helvane Core held flat to protect volume. Bundled maintenance discounts remain unchanged. Please ensure quoting tools are updated and that in-flight proposals honor current pricing for thirty days. Direct customer questions to your regional lead. The rationale behind this adjustment is outlined below.

confidential, bahap-bajog: Zorethix Works is in early talks to buy Kelethox Foods for about $30.7 million. The Ralvan launch date is September 19, and nothing goes to the press before then.